Step 1: Understand Fiqh al-Lughah
- Definition: Fiqh al-Lughah refers to the jurisprudence of language, exploring how linguistic elements impact understanding and interpretation in Arabic.
- Importance: This concept is crucial for linguists and scholars as it bridges language and cultural studies, enhancing comprehension of Arabic texts.
- Historical Context: Familiarize yourself with the evolution of Fiqh al-Lughah among Arab linguists and its relevance in contemporary linguistic analysis.
Step 2: Explore the Emergence of Fiqh al-Lughah
- Key Figures: Learn about influential linguists who contributed to the field, such as Al-Jahiz and Ibn Jinni, and their foundational theories.
- Development Stages: Study the historical phases in which Fiqh al-Lughah evolved, noting the shifts in focus from purely grammatical analysis to a more holistic understanding of language in context.
- Cultural Influence: Recognize how cultural shifts in the Arab world have influenced the study and interpretation of language.
Step 3: Research Methodologies in Language Studies
- Qualitative vs. Quantitative Approaches: Understand the difference between these methods and when to apply each in linguistic research.
- Qualitative: Involves in-depth studies of language use in context, narrative analysis, and case studies.
- Quantitative: Focuses on statistical analysis of language patterns and usage through surveys and experiments.
- Data Collection Techniques: Identify effective ways to gather linguistic data, such as interviews, observations, and corpus analysis.
